“…The process of digital image analysis depends on the definition of regions of interest (ROI), representing a region within the sample image defined for analysis (see Richardson et al., ; Alberton et al., , ). An ROI represents an individual tree crown (our study case), populations, or a community or vegetation type within the landscape (Richardson et al., ; Alberton et al., ). From each ROI, we extract vegetation indices from red, green, and blue (RGB) color channels of the digital images (Richardson et al., ; Sonnentag et al., ; Filippa et al., ).…”
